With the departure of the Aprilia I'm down to seven now, four of which are legal and running. All on a CN multi-bike policy, £235 FC with Euro breakdown. CN getting too expensive and can't be arsed ringing round everywhere? Simply make up a cheaper quote and tell them you're not renewing - they soon come back with something more realistic. I've done this on every one of the last five renewals when these shysters have tried to bend me over.

I've got the Kymco and the Triumph insured through CN too but every year I have to put up with an inflated renewal quote which I then have to bargain down exactly as described by Jaz. They always seem to miraculously find a big saving with a different underwriter in spite of their initial letter saying they always work in the customers' best interests.
